/**
* The following is used to initialize the CPRBX passed to the PCIXCC/CEX2C
* card in a type6 message. The 3 fields that must be filled in at execution
* time are req_parml, rpl_parml and usage_domain.
* Everything about this interface is ascii/big-endian, since the
* device does *not* have 'Intel inside'.
*
* The CPRBX is followed immediately by the parm block.
* The parm block contains:
* - function code ('PD' 0x5044 or 'PK' 0x504B)
* - rule block (one of:)
* + 0x000A 'PKCS-1.2' (MCL2 'PD')
* + 0x000A 'ZERO-PAD' (MCL2 'PK')
* + 0x000A 'ZERO-PAD' (MCL3 'PD' or CEX2C 'PD')
* + 0x000A 'MRP ' (MCL3 'PK' or CEX2C 'PK')
* - VUD block
*/
static struct CPRBX static_cprbx = {
.cprb_len = 0x00DC,
.cprb_ver_id = 0x02,
.func_id = {0x54,0x32},
};
/**
* Convert a ICAMEX message to a type6 MEX message.
*
* @zdev: crypto device pointer
* @ap_msg: pointer to AP message
* @mex: pointer to user input data
*
* Returns 0 on success or -EFAULT.
*/
static int ICAMEX_msg_to_type6MEX_msgX(struct zcrypt_device *zdev,
struct ap_message *ap_msg,
struct ica_rsa_modexpo *mex)
{
static struct type6_hdr static_type6_hdrX = {
.type = 0x06,
.offset1 = 0x00000058,
.agent_id = {'C','A',},
.function_code = {'P','K'},
};
static struct function_and_rules_block static_pke_fnr = {
.function_code = {'P','K'},
.ulen = 10,
.only_rule = {'M','R','P',' ',' ',' ',' ',' '}
};
static struct function_and_rules_block static_pke_fnr_MCL2 = {
.function_code = {'P','K'},
.ulen = 10,
.only_rule = {'Z','E','R','O','-','P','A','D'}
};
struct {
struct type6_hdr hdr;
struct CPRBX cprbx;
struct function_and_rules_block fr;
unsigned short length;
char text[0];
} __attribute__((packed)) *msg = ap_msg->message;
int size;
/* VUD.ciphertext */
msg->length = mex->inputdatalength + 2;
if (copy_from_user(msg->text, mex->inputdata, mex->inputdatalength))
return -EFAULT;
/* Set up key which is located after the variable length text. */
size = zcrypt_type6_mex_key_en(mex, msg->text+mex->inputdatalength, 1);
if (size < 0)
return size;
size += sizeof(*msg) + mex->inputdatalength;
/* message header, cprbx and f&r */
msg->hdr = static_type6_hdrX;
msg->hdr.ToCardLen1 = size - sizeof(msg->hdr);
msg->hdr.FromCardLen1 = PCIXCC_MAX_ICA_RESPONSE_SIZE - sizeof(msg->hdr);
msg->cprbx = static_cprbx;
msg->cprbx.domain = AP_QID_QUEUE(zdev->ap_dev->qid);
msg->cprbx.rpl_msgbl = msg->hdr.FromCardLen1;
msg->fr = (zdev->user_space_type == ZCRYPT_PCIXCC_MCL2) ?
static_pke_fnr_MCL2 : static_pke_fnr;
msg->cprbx.req_parml = size - sizeof(msg->hdr) - sizeof(msg->cprbx);
ap_msg->length = size;
return 0;
}

/**
* Convert a XCRB message to a type6 CPRB message.
*
* @zdev: crypto device pointer
* @ap_msg: pointer to AP message
* @xcRB: pointer to user input data
*
* Returns 0 on success or -EFAULT.
*/
struct type86_fmt2_msg {
struct type86_hdr hdr;
struct type86_fmt2_ext fmt2;
} __attribute__((packed));
static int XCRB_msg_to_type6CPRB_msgX(struct zcrypt_device *zdev,
struct ap_message *ap_msg,
struct ica_xcRB *xcRB)
{
static struct type6_hdr static_type6_hdrX = {
.type = 0x06,
.offset1 = 0x00000058,
};
struct {
struct type6_hdr hdr;
struct CPRBX cprbx;
} __attribute__((packed)) *msg = ap_msg->message;
int rcblen = CEIL4(xcRB->request_control_blk_length);
int replylen;
char *req_data = ap_msg->message + sizeof(struct type6_hdr) + rcblen;
char *function_code;
/* length checks */
ap_msg->length = sizeof(struct type6_hdr) +
CEIL4(xcRB->request_control_blk_length) +
xcRB->request_data_length;
if (ap_msg->length > P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_MESSAGE_SIZE)
return -EFAULT;
if (CEIL4(xcRB->reply_control_blk_length) > P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_REPLY_SIZE)
return -EFAULT;
if (CEIL4(xcRB->reply_data_length) > P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_DATA_SIZE)
return -EFAULT;
replylen = CEIL4(xcRB->reply_control_blk_length) +
CEIL4(xcRB->reply_data_length) +
sizeof(struct type86_fmt2_msg);
if (replylen > P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_RESPONSE_SIZE) {
xcRB->reply_control_blk_length = P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_RESPONSE_SIZE -
(sizeof(struct type86_fmt2_msg) +
CEIL4(xcRB->reply_data_length));
}
/* prepare type6 header */
msg->hdr = static_type6_hdrX;
memcpy(msg->hdr.agent_id , &(xcRB->agent_ID), sizeof(xcRB->agent_ID));
msg->hdr.ToCardLen1 = xcRB->request_control_blk_length;
if (xcRB->request_data_length) {
msg->hdr.offset2 = msg->hdr.offset1 + rcblen;
msg->hdr.ToCardLen2 = xcRB->request_data_length;
}
msg->hdr.FromCardLen1 = xcRB->reply_control_blk_length;
msg->hdr.FromCardLen2 = xcRB->reply_data_length;
/* prepare CPRB */
if (copy_from_user(&(msg->cprbx), xcRB->request_control_blk_addr,
xcRB->request_control_blk_length))
return -EFAULT;
if (msg->cprbx.cprb_len + sizeof(msg->hdr.function_code) >
xcRB->request_control_blk_length)
return -EFAULT;
function_code = ((unsigned char *)&msg->cprbx) + msg->cprbx.cprb_len;
memcpy(msg->hdr.function_code, function_code, sizeof(msg->hdr.function_code));
if (memcmp(function_code, "US", 2) == 0)
ap_msg->special = 1;
else
ap_msg->special = 0;
/* copy data block */
if (xcRB->request_data_length &&
copy_from_user(req_data, xcRB->request_data_address,
xcRB->request_data_length))
return -EFAULT;
return 0;
}

/**
* This function is called from the AP bus code after a crypto request
* "msg" has finished with the reply message "reply".
* It is called from tasklet context.
* @ap_dev: pointer to the AP device
* @msg: pointer to the AP message
* @reply: pointer to the AP reply message
*/
static void zcrypt_pcixcc_receive(struct ap_device *ap_dev,
struct ap_message *msg,
struct ap_message *reply)
{
static struct error_hdr error_reply = {
.type = TYPE82_RSP_CODE,
.reply_code = REP82_ERROR_MACHINE_FAILURE,
};
struct response_type *resp_type =
(struct response_type *) msg->private;
struct type86x_reply *t86r;
int length;
/* Copy the reply message to the request message buffer. */
if (IS_ERR(reply)) {
memcpy(msg->message, &error_reply, sizeof(error_reply));
goto out;
}
t86r = reply->message;
if (t86r->hdr.type == TYPE86_RSP_CODE &&
t86r->cprbx.cprb_ver_id == 0x02) {
switch (resp_type->type) {
case PCIXCC_RESPONSE_TYPE_ICA:
length = sizeof(struct type86x_reply)
+ t86r->length - 2;
length = min(PCIXCC_MAX_ICA_RESPONSE_SIZE, length);
memcpy(msg->message, reply->message, length);
break;
case PCIXCC_RESPONSE_TYPE_XCRB:
length = t86r->fmt2.offset2 + t86r->fmt2.count2;
length = min(PCIXCC_MAX_XCRB_RESPONSE_SIZE, length);
memcpy(msg->message, reply->message, length);
break;
default:
memcpy(msg->message, &error_reply, sizeof error_reply);
}
} else
memcpy(msg->message, reply->message, sizeof error_reply);
out:
complete(&(resp_type->work));
}

/**
* Probe function for PCIXCC/CEX2C cards. It always accepts the AP device
* since the bus_match already checked the hardware type. The PCIXCC
* cards come in two flavours: micro code level 2 and micro code level 3.
* This is checked by sending a test message to the device.
* @ap_dev: pointer to the AP device.
*/
static int zcrypt_pcixcc_probe(struct ap_device *ap_dev)
{
struct zcrypt_device *zdev;
int rc = 0;
zdev = zcrypt_device_alloc(PCIXCC_MAX_RESPONSE_SIZE);
if (!zdev)
return -ENOMEM;
zdev->ap_dev = ap_dev;
zdev->online = 1;
switch (ap_dev->device_type) {
case AP_DEVICE_TYPE_PCIXCC:
rc = zcrypt_pcixcc_mcl(ap_dev);
if (rc < 0) {
zcrypt_device_free(zdev);
return rc;
}
zdev->user_space_type = rc;
if (rc == ZCRYPT_PCIXCC_MCL2) {
zdev->type_string = "PCIXCC_MCL2";
zdev->speed_rating = PCIXCC_MCL2_SPEED_RATING;
zdev->min_mod_size = PCIXCC_MIN_MOD_SIZE_OLD;
zdev->max_mod_size =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_exp_bit_length =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
} else {
zdev->type_string = "PCIXCC_MCL3";
zdev->speed_rating = PCIXCC_MCL3_SPEED_RATING;
zdev->min_mod_size = PCIXCC_MIN_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_mod_size =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_exp_bit_length =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
}
break;
case AP_DEVICE_TYPE_CEX2C:
zdev->user_space_type = ZCRYPT_CEX2C;
zdev->type_string = "CEX2C";
zdev->speed_rating = CEX2C_SPEED_RATING;
zdev->min_mod_size = PCIXCC_MIN_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_mod_size =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_exp_bit_length = PCIXCC_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
break;
case AP_DEVICE_TYPE_CEX3C:
zdev->user_space_type = ZCRYPT_CEX3C;
zdev->type_string = "CEX3C";
zdev->speed_rating = CEX3C_SPEED_RATING;
zdev->min_mod_size = CEX3C_MIN_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_mod_size = CEX3C_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
zdev->max_exp_bit_length = CEX3C_MAX_MOD_SIZE;
break;
default:
goto out_free;
}
rc = zcrypt_pcixcc_rng_supported(ap_dev);
if (rc < 0) {
zcrypt_device_free(zdev);
return rc;
}
if (rc)
zdev->ops = &zcrypt_pcixcc_with_rng_ops;
else
zdev->ops = &zcrypt_pcixcc_ops;
ap_dev->reply = &zdev->reply;
ap_dev->private = zdev;
rc = zcrypt_device_register(zdev);
if (rc)
goto out_free;
return 0;
out_free:
ap_dev->private = NULL;
zcrypt_device_free(zdev);
return rc;
}
